Eastern Flattens Ravens In Season Opener

ST. DAVIDS, Pa. - The Rosemont College women's basketball team lost decisively in their opener against the Eastern University Eagles this evening, losing by a final score of 81-50. The non-conference game was the season-opener for both teams.

The Ravens gave away the ball more than twice as many times as Eastern (25-12) and shot only 31.3% from the field and 22.2% from the line to seal their fate.

The Eagles won the game leading wire-to-wire. Rosemont went into the locker room at the half trailing by their largest margin to that point, 35-23.

Eastern continued to put distance between themselves and the Ravens, extending their lead in the second half to 48-30 with 16:25 left. The Ravens scratched themselves back into contention as they went on an 8-0 run to get back to within 48-38. But that would be the closest that Rosemont would get to the Eagles for the remainder of the game as the home side pulled away to earn the victory.

First year Liz Coyne (West Chester, Pa.) was the only Raven to hit double-figures, scoring 20 points on 10-20 shooting from the field. First year guard Brittany Wilson (Philadelphia, Pa.) scored nine points, all from beyond the 3-point arc (3-4 from downtown). Junior Ashley Montecchio (Aston, Pa.) and first year April Buck (Darby, Pa.) led the Ravens with seven boards each.
